Transaction df113536dda284541e518d5b91c61f645136efde5cea7506c6f655c5a7209582
1 Input
-
277314325cc67b77c020d58bb05a101c30c0e00c40051d267d80f4e690761b38:1
OP_DATA_48(48) 4402203329a08cb74c36e82a38940ad284d2cd6fd69b9690b18ae820838b99f8b5bbf102202e3a0ca1ff3059a2bb0f13OP_UNKNOWN203(203)
1 Outputs
- df113536dda284541e518d5b91c61f645136efde5cea7506c6f655c5a7209582:0
value 4993067
address 3EcAuDWecst7cJUXkkgujCq9evwJsSpUnU